Circus Vazquez - Plaza Fiesta

A fourth-generation Mexican family circus pitches its blue-and-white big top in the Plaza Fiesta parking lot when the tour swings through Atlanta. Circus Vazquez at 4166 Buford Highway NE, on the grounds of the Plaza Fiesta mall in the heart of Atlanta's pan-Latin Buford Highway corridor, is a recurring stop for the touring production of Circo Hermanos Vazquez, founded in Mexico City in 1969 by brothers Jose Guillermo and Rafael Vazquez under a tent their family stitched by hand. Sloomoo Institute - Atlanta

Built around the surprisingly soothing pleasures of slime, the Sloomoo Institute Atlanta is an immersive, sensory experience that elevates a childhood plaything into an entire afternoon of tactile fun. An offshoot of an original venue in New York that drew enormous crowds, the brand has expanded into several American cities with locations devoted to play, design and a vivid, candy-coloured aesthetic that flows from room to room.
